Charitable purposes

The purpose of the Squadron Association ('the Association') is to fully support the squadron commander to further the objects of the Air Training Corps ('the ATC') as contained in the Schedule to the Royal Warrant and as amended from time to time but in particular to support activities which foster the spirit of adventure amongst the squadron's cadets and develop their qualities of leadership and good citizenship.
